HonCC to Participate In Next Year’s Great Aloha President’s Run

By: Jordan Brown

The HonCC Great Aloha Run (GAR) committee has agreed to participate in the 2020 Presidents’ 100 Club #47. The school has requested for at least 100 runners to participate in the race in order to qualify as an official entrant. We encourage everyone on campus and their affiliates ranging from students, faculty, staff, administration, retirees, friends, and family to participate in this event. Last year’s event saw 110 entrants join the President’s 100 Club #47. Next year bears great significance as it also marks our centennial anniversary of the founding of our school!

The event will take place on President’s Day on February 17, 2020. We hope to exceed expectations this year by increasing the amount of participants compared to last year’s 110 entrants. The race will be approximately 8.15 miles long, beginning at Aloha Tower and ending at Aloha Stadium.
